Why Pest Control Companies win or lose the first Google scroll

The local map block and your first screen on the site earn the jobs. Almost everything else waits behind those two.

  • Pest searches split between same-day infestations and recurring prevention plans, and the two need very different pages.
  • Anxious customers want proof you are licensed and safe around children and pets before they will call at all.
  • Many pests are seasonal, so demand for wasps, rodents, or bed bugs swings through the year.
  • Recurring contracts, not one-off jobs, are where the margin is, so the site should sell the plan, not just the single visit.

How we approach Pest Control Companies

  1. 1

    Separate same-day jobs from prevention plans

    An urgent infestation and a yearly plan are searched for differently and sold differently.

  2. 2

    Lead with safety and licensing

    Reassurance about children, pets, and credentials is the deciding factor, so make it impossible to miss.

  3. 3

    Plan for seasonal pests

    Wasps, rodents, and bed bugs peak at different times, so pages and ads should track the calendar.

  4. 4

    Turn one-off calls into contracts

    What we grow is booked treatments and the plans behind them.
